The Internet Corporation for Assigned Names and Numbers (ICANN) has opened applications for the NextGen@ICANN87 programme, inviting university students from the Asia Pacific region to participate in its upcoming annual meeting.
The programme will run alongside the ICANN87 Annual General Meeting, scheduled for 17–22 October 2026 in Muscat, Oman. Applications are open from 23 March to 1 May 2026, with selected candidates to be announced on 7 July 2026.
NextGen@ICANN is aimed at students aged 18 to 30 who are interested in internet governance and the technical coordination of the internet. Participants receive training on topics such as the domain name system, policy development and the multistakeholder model, and are expected to complete preparatory sessions and present their work during the meeting.
The programme is part of ICANN’s broader efforts to support youth engagement and build capacity in global internet governance processes.
